How to restart your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E:
Restarting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E does not delete any data from your phone. In case you want to delete all data from your phone, you can get a step by step guide here.
You should keep in mind that you must know your device’s password for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E, as you will require it when your mobile device is turned on again.
- Press & Hold the Power/Unlock Button on your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E until you see your smartphone’s screen with a few options.
- Choose the Restart or Reboot menu among the various options on your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E’s screen. (If it’s asking for confirmation, tap on accept)
- Now your phone will turn off & on again to perform the restart. Wait for a while, and now it will ask you for your mobile’s password or fingerprint.
Once you confirm your mobile phone’s unlock code on your phone, it’s successfully restarted now.
Troubleshooting guide for restarting the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E:
How to reboot your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E in case it’s not responding?
Sometimes, your mobile device performs slow while playing a game or doing some heavy task on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E. You can not continue the current task on your phone. At that time, you will need to proceed with rebooting your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E using physical buttons.
Suppose you want to do a force reboot of your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E; press and hold the power button for at least 8 to 10 seconds until you see Android Logo or huawei logo appearing on your screen. Now release the button to let it start again.
Sometimes, your device is not responding even with physical buttons. You can not even force restart your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E. There are chances that your phone has a low battery. The only solution in that scenario is to plug in your charging wire and try again.
If you still see Huawei Ascend D1 XL U9500E not responding even after following the above guidelines and you see it has entered into boot loop mode, it’s possible that there is some issue with your device. You should take it to the nearby Huawei service center.
